Zendaya leaned into cinematic storytelling once again, stepping out at CinemaCon 2026 in a look that felt deeply connected to the world she’s currently bringing to life on screen. The annual Las Vegas event, where studios preview upcoming films to theater owners, set the stage for a press moment that blurred the lines between fashion and film.
Zendaya wears structural Schiaparelli skirt suit for ‘Dune: Part Three’ at CinemaCon 2026
For the occasion, she wore a custom Schiaparelli Fall/Winter 2026 skirt suit, styled by Law Roach. At first glance, the ensemble reads clean and tailored, but its construction quickly reveals something far more sculptural. The sharply structured jacket features exaggerated, architectural shoulders and a wide, pointed collar that frames the neckline with precision. The bodice is shaped to mimic her body structure, creating a trompe-l’œil effect that plays with illusion and structure.
Paired with a fitted, knee-length skirt, the look maintains a streamlined silhouette while still carrying the drama of couture craftsmanship. The color palette features muted, sandy hues that feel intentional, subtly referencing the desert landscape inspired by the Dune universe. Zendaya embraces theme dressing, but executes it carefully and intelligently rather than in excess.
Zendaya completed the look with classic Christian Louboutin So Kate pumps in a little dark neutral tone, elongating the silhouette further. Her hair was slicked back into a short, wet look style, keeping the focus firmly on the garment’s structure. She opted for minimal jewelry, which included Bondeye piece-by-piece hoops. These added a touch of sparkle while allowing the outfit’s detailing to take center stage.
Set against the Warner Bros. and CinemaCon backdrop, the look stood out not through color, but through design. It is a reminder of Zendaya’s ability to transform press tour dressing into something more story-driven, where each outfit feels like an extension of the story she’s telling.
